Teaching
Professional Courses:
- Advanced Computing for Executives (ACE), School of Computing:
- Advanced Computing for Executives (ACE), School of Computing, in collaboration with Emeritus:
- Cybersecurity online programme: programme faculty (co-teaching with Dr. Guo Charng Rang)
I'm excited to be a part of Cybersecurity online programme developed by ACE, School of Computing, NUS in collaboration with Emeritus. In this programme, we'll delve into insightful topics - from fundamentals of cybersecurity and best practices in cybersecurity to key concepts and tactics to prevent cyberattacks. During this learning journey, we'll deep dive into various key topics such as entity authentication, preventive measures for password cracking, network security, malware, web security, trends of cybersecurity and many more.
Degree Courses:
*: Nominated for teaching awards by some students (in the student feedback exercise) for the lecturing
AY 2023/2024:
- Current Semester II (Jan-May 2024):
- IFS4102 Digital Forensics: lecturer
- IFS4103 Penetration Testing Practice: module coordinator (to be assisted by Ensign InfoSecurity Singapore)
- Semester I (Aug-Dec 2023):
- CS2107 Introduction to Information Security: lecturer*
- TIC2301 Introduction to Information Security (NUS SCALE module): co-lecturer*
AY 2022/2023:
- Semester II (Jan-May 2023):
- IFS4102 Digital Forensics: lecturer*, with student rating of 4.1/5.0
- CS4238 Computer Security Practice: co-lecturer*
- TIC4304 Web Security (NUS SCALE module): co-lecturer*, with student rating of 4.2/5.0
- Semester I (Aug-Dec 2022):
- CS2107 Introduction to Information Security: lecturer*
- Lecture slides: now significantly streamlined by refocusing on key topics and concepts: an adjustment done based on the previous year's feedback
- Assignments: now made more in line with the lecture material, with clearer questions and guiding hints given; challenging questions are capped at 15% in each assignment
- TIC2301 Introduction to Information Security (NUS SCALE module): co-lecturer*
- IFS4103 Penetration Testing Practice: module coordinator (assisting Deloitte Singapore), with a new/improved peer-review based project grading scheme
AY 2021/2022:
- Semester II (Jan-May 2022):
- IFS4102 Digital Forensics: lecturer*, with student rating of 4.1/5.0 (SoC Faculty average=4.2/5.0)
- TIC4304 Web Security (NUS SCALE module): co-lecturer*, with student rating of 4.4/5.0 (SCALE Faculty average=4.1/5.0)
- CS2107 Introduction to Information Security: tutor (supporting Assoc. Prof. Chang Ee-Chien)
- Semester I (Aug-Dec 2021):
- CS2107 Introduction to Information Security: lecturer*
- With increased topic coverage due to the module's syllabus change as directed by the Department: perhaps with too many lecture slides in this run :(
- TIC2301 Introduction to Information Security (NUS SCALE module): co-lecturer*
- IFS4103 Penetration Testing Practice: module coordinator (assisting Deloitte Singapore)
AY 2020/2021:
- Semester II (Jan-May 2021):
- Semester I (Aug-Dec 2020):
AY 2019/2020:
- Semester II (Jan-May 2020):
Semester I (Aug-Dec 2019):
AY 2018/2019:
- Semester II (Jan-May 2019):
- Semester I (Aug-Dec 2018):
AY 2017/2018:
- Semester II (Jan-May 2018):
- Semester I (Aug-Dec 2017):
- CS2107 Introduction to Information Security: lecturer*
- CS1231 Discrete Structures: tutor (assisting Assoc. Prof. Aaron Tan & Assoc. Prof. Terence Sim)
AY 2016/2017:
- Semester II (Jan-May 2017):